Sažetak
The article shows the exemple of how the process of the inter-religious dialogue and cooperation went through during the war time in Croatia (1991-1995) and soon after that time. The incentive for the cooperation came from the members of two movements - from Cursillo, the laic Catholic movement and the MRA/IofC (Moral-Re-Armament and the Initiatives of Change). They all worked together in forgiveness, forgetting and reconciliation in this region. It shows how religious individuals and groups built the paths of peace togeether, starting with their faqith and their own growth in love towards God and people How the members of the Orthodox and Jewish religion foined that process of interreligious coperation and, what is especially important, a great contribuation was made by the Islamic community in Croatia led by mufti. That is how the members of the two aforementioned movements, each in their own way and inspired by their own religion, cooperted in introduction of a just peace. This is followed by a conclusion that in that process individuals and groups jointly contrituted to peace and constructive cooperation within society, based on their own faith, tradition and spirituality, but without syncretism.
